Restoration of TET2 deficiency inhibits tumor growth in head neck squamous cell carcinoma

BACKGROUND: Tet methylcytosine dioxygenase 2 (TET2) has been increasingly recognized as an important tumor suppressor involved in tumorigenesis. Here, we aimed to explore the expression pattern of TET2, its clinical significance as well as functional roles in head neck squamous cell carcinoma (HNSCC...
